Single-purpose databases were designed to address specific problems and use cases. Given this narrow focus, there are inherent tradeoffs required when trying to accommodate multiple datatypes or workloads in your enterprise environment. The result is data fragmentation that spills over into application development, IT operations, data security, system scalability, and availability.
In this report, we explain why developing data-driven apps with a single data platform potentially makes more sense than cobbling together numerous specialty databases. We discuss how you can use the latest techniques in software architecture—such as microservices, event streaming, REST (representational state transfer) APIs, and SaaS (software as a service) models—by taking advantage of the synergistic data technologies within a converged database, and that you can even analyze unstructured data such as graph, spatial, or JSON (javascript object notation) data without having to convert it. By providing the perspectives and examples of real-world practitioners from a variety of verticals, we will demonstrate how a converged database can streamline data management and ultimately allow businesses to achieve a competitive edge.
Data-Driven Applications: The New Gold Standard of Enterprise Software. Data-driven apps are apps that use diverse sets of data—document data, sensor data, spatial data, transactional data, and more—to help businesses derive immediate value from that data. These diverse sets of data are typically taken from multiple sources in real time.
